Replacing the rear fan assembly

Attention

Do not open your computer or attempt any repair before reading and understanding the “Important safety information” in the ThinkStation Safety and Warranty Guide that came with your computer. To obtain a copy of the ThinkStation Safety and Warranty Guide, go to: http://www.lenovo.com/support

This section provides instructions on how to replace the rear fan assembly.

To replace the rear fan assembly, do the following:

1.Remove the computer cover. See “Removing the computer cover” on page 14.

2.Locate the rear fan assembly. See “Locating components” on page 10.

3.Disconnect the rear fan assembly cable from the system fan connector on the system board. See “Locating parts on the system board” on page 11.

4.The rear fan assembly is attached to the chassis by four rubber mounts. Remove the rear fan assembly by breaking or cutting the four rubber mounts and gently pulling the rear fan assembly out of the chassis.

Figure 30. Removing the rear fan assembly

5.Install the new rear fan assembly by aligning the new rubber mounts with the corresponding holes in the chassis and push the rubber mounts through the holes.

Note: The new rear fan assembly you received will have four new rubber mounts attached.
